  1. Dorothy Ierne Wilde, nota anche come Dolly Wilde ( Londra, 11 luglio 1895 – 10 aprile 1941) è stata una traduttrice e socialite britannica . Biografia. Dorothy Wilde nacque a Londra nel 1895, tre mesi dopo l'arresto dello zio Oscar Wilde. La Wilde era la figlia di Willie Wilde, fratello dello scrittore, e Sophie Lily Lees.

  2. Dorothy Ierne Wilde, known as Dolly Wilde (11 July 1895 – 10 April 1941), was an English socialite, made famous by her family connections and her reputation as a witty conversationalist. Her charm and humour made her a popular guest at salons in Paris between the wars, standing out even in a social circle known for its flamboyant ...

  3. Joan Schenkar (15 August 1942 - 5 May 2021) was an American playwright and writer. She is known for her biographies of writer Patricia Highsmith, and Dorothy Wilde, as well as for the production of several of her plays in New York in the 1980s, including Signs of Life, Cabin Fever, and The Last of Hitler .
